Alma College students willingly express their appreciation for the scholarships they receive. The following letter by Richard Allen ’12 to Sally Posey is shared by permission.

Richard Allen '12

Richard Allen ’12

Dear Mrs. Sally Posey:
The Lee and Sally Souders Posey Endowed Scholarship greatly impacted my life. The scholarship allowed me to work with children both in orphanages and on the streets throughout Ukraine. This experience also has opened my mind to a culture that is fascinating and unforgettable.
I became particularly fond of one child, Christina. She was in the sad situation of her dad being in prison so she will never get the chance to be adopted. But being a mentor to her, we were able to give her clothes, toys, hope and love.
This scholarship is the reason that Alma impacts countless lives across the world. You haven’t just changed my life, but the lives of countless people globally.
